Transaction 65250bdbbcc488150151bf64fa59f7fee79dedf914103e41da43ea7d2c38f0c1

1 Input
2 Outputs
  • 65250bdbbcc488150151bf64fa59f7fee79dedf914103e41da43ea7d2c38f0c1:0
  • value  12674735
    address  33CJcJSLgp5dXr8BZjhURGJFaeRHcCMtci
  • 65250bdbbcc488150151bf64fa59f7fee79dedf914103e41da43ea7d2c38f0c1:1
  • value  2459934033
    address  35vmc6PATubLjn6jcUBmQYoiLWxSKyNuiZ